4v4 Team Deathmatch (TDM)
4v4 Team Deathmatch is one of the core modes of “Battle Stars,” and it epitomizes the game’s emphasis on tactical teamwork and precision. In this mode, two teams of four players each face off in close-quarters combat across various maps designed to encourage both strategic positioning and frantic skirmishes.
Gameplay Mechanics
- Objective: The primary goal in TDM is simple—eliminate members of the opposing team. Each kill contributes to the team’s score, and the first team to reach a predetermined number of kills or the team with the highest score when the timer expires is declared the winner.
- Maps: The maps for TDM are intricately designed to support a variety of playstyles. They feature a mix of open spaces for long-range engagements and tight corridors for close-quarters battles. Each map includes multiple levels, vantage points, and cover options, making map knowledge crucial for success.
- Weaponry and Loadouts: Players can choose from a diverse arsenal of weapons, including assault rifles, shotguns, sniper rifles, and more. Loadout customization allows players to tailor their gear to their preferred playstyle, whether they favor stealthy sniping or aggressive close-range combat.
- Tactics and Strategy: Success in TDM relies heavily on team coordination. Effective communication and teamwork are essential for executing strategies such as flanking maneuvers, coordinating suppressive fire, and securing key positions on the map. Players must balance offensive and defensive roles to maximize their team’s effectiveness.
- Skill Progression: The mode includes a ranking system that rewards players for their performance, encouraging continuous improvement and skill development. Players earn experience points and unlock new equipment and abilities as they advance through the ranks.

Battle Royale (BR)
Battle Royale (BR) is another prominent mode in “Battle Stars,” offering a stark contrast to the structured chaos of TDM. In BR, players are dropped into a large, open map where they must scavenge for resources, engage in combat, and outlast other players to claim victory.
Gameplay Mechanics
- Objective: Unlike TDM, the objective in BR is to be the last player or team standing. The map gradually shrinks over time, forcing players into increasingly smaller play areas and escalating the intensity of encounters as the match progresses.
- Map and Environment: The BR map is expansive and varied, featuring diverse terrain such as urban environments, forests, and mountainous regions. This diversity requires players to adapt their strategies based on their surroundings and the changing dynamics of the shrinking play area.
- Loot and Resources: Players start with minimal equipment and must scavenge the map for weapons, armor, and other resources. The loot system is randomized, which adds an element of unpredictability and strategy to each match. Players must make quick decisions about which items to prioritize and how to effectively use their resources.
- Survival Elements: The BR mode incorporates survival elements such as health regeneration, environmental hazards, and limited resources. Players must manage their health, avoid danger zones, and make tactical decisions to ensure their survival.
- Team Dynamics: While BR can be played solo, it also supports team-based gameplay, allowing players to form squads and strategize together. Team communication and coordination are crucial for navigating the map, engaging in combat, and surviving the increasingly hostile environment.

Comparative Analysis: TDM vs. BR
**1. *Gameplay Focus*: TDM is centered around structured, team-based combat with clear objectives and immediate feedback, while BR emphasizes survival, resource management, and adaptability in a larger, evolving environment.
**2. *Strategy and Tactics*: TDM requires precise coordination and tactical decision-making within a fixed map, whereas BR demands broader strategic thinking and adaptability to changing conditions and a shrinking play area.
**3. *Community Engagement*: Both modes foster strong communities, but TDM tends to appeal to players who prefer competitive, team-oriented gameplay, while BR attracts those who enjoy the thrill of survival and large-scale combat.
